Introduction to Ashotone

Ashotone is a non-hormonal herbomineral formulation developed to address various gynecological disorders, with a particular focus on heavy menstrual bleeding. Unlike traditional hormonal treatments, Ashotone utilizes a blend of carefully selected herbs and minerals to restore balance and alleviate symptoms naturally. This medicine offers a promising alternative for individuals seeking non-hormonal solutions for menstrual irregularities and other women's health issues.

What Is Ashotone?

Ashotone is an Ayurvedic-inspired herbomineral medicine formulated from natural ingredients known for their efficacy in treating gynecological concerns. It is designed to regulate menstrual flow, reduce heavy bleeding, and improve overall reproductive health without the use of synthetic hormones. The formulation combines the wisdom of traditional herbal medicine with mineral compounds to create a synergistic effect that supports the body’s innate healing processes.

How Does Ashotone Work?

Ashotone works by leveraging the combined properties of its herbal and mineral components to:

  • Balance the doshas (Vata, Pitta, Kapha) as per Ayurvedic principles
  • Strengthen the uterine lining and reduce inflammation
  • Regulate blood flow by promoting proper clotting and vessel health
  • Support hormonal balance indirectly through its non-hormonal mechanisms, reducing the reliance on synthetic hormones

The specific formulation in Ashotone is designed to target the physiological processes that contribute to heavy menstrual bleeding, promoting healing and balance in a holistic manner.

Potential Side Effects & Precautions

While Ashotone is designed to be gentle and non-hormonal, consider the following precautions:

  • Allergies: Check the ingredient list for any potential allergens. Perform a patch test or start with a lower dose if you have sensitive reactions.
  • Pregnancy and Nursing: Consult a healthcare professional before using Ashotone if you are pregnant, planning to become pregnant, or breastfeeding.
  • Interactions: Inform your practitioner of any other medications or supplements you are taking to avoid possible interactions.
  • Monitoring: Regularly monitor your symptoms and report any unexpected changes or side effects to your healthcare provider.
